為指導鄭西鐵路客運專線做好施工期間的沉降觀測,通過對路基、橋梁及隧道工程的沉降觀測資料進行分析,預測工后沉降,提出加速路基沉降的措施,確定無碴軌道的鋪設時間,評估路基工后沉降控制效果,確保無碴軌道結(jié)構(gòu)的安全,制定本指導方案。In order to direct ZhengXi PDL to do well settlement observation during construction, establish this directing scheme by analyzing settlement observation data of subgrades, bridges, and tunnels, forecasting settlement after construction, raising accelerating subgrade settlement measurement, confirming the time of paving slabtrack, evaluating the controlling effect of subgrade settlement after construction, making sure safety of slabtrack structure. 無碴軌道鋪設條件評估的重點應是線下工程的變形,評估應綜合考慮沿線路方向各種結(jié)構(gòu)物間的變形關系,以標段為單位實施。設計單位按照本指導方案,以標段為單位制定沉降觀測實施設計方案。Evaluation keypoints of slabtrack paving conditions should be deformation of underline construction. Evaluation should synthetically consider deformation relation among different structures along alienment, implement by section. Contractors should establish settlement observation implement design scheme by section according to this scheme. 基礎工程的沉降觀測數(shù)據(jù)必須采用先進、成熟、科學的檢測手段取得,且必須真實可靠,全面反映工程實際狀況。Settlement observation data of foundation engineering should be gott
